This week Holly Marshall (Wales), Laurie Devine (Scotland) and Hannah Bowley (England) will represent their countries at the Commonwealth Youth Games.

 

The Commonwealth Youth Games are hosted every four years, across all sports and involve all countries within the Commonwealth. This year the Games will be hosted in Trinidad & Tobago, with the swimming taking place between 6th-9th August 2023.

 

Holly Marshall (Y12) will represent Wales in the 200m Butterfly, 200m Backstroke, 400m IM and Relay events. Laurie Devine (Y12) will represent Scotland in the 50m Freestyle, 100m Freestyle and Relay events. Hannah Bowley (Y13) will represent England in the 50m Breaststroke, 100m Breaststroke and 200m Breaststroke events.

 

Director of Swimming, Ash Morris wished the girls good luck; “Our girls are representing their home nations for the first time and it is a really exciting event that they can be proud of competing in. Whilst they may be representing their country during the competition, they will all also be representing Repton and I can speak for the whole of the club in wishing them good luck!”
